Our church community is committed to the lifelong process of religious growth and learning. In our Sunday School classes, we work to provide a loving and nurturing environment where children and youth are able to explore their beliefs, deepen their understanding of the sacred and enrich their religious lives. We strive to create a supportive atmosphere where our young people can be themselves while learning to acknowledge, accept, and affirm differences in others.
For Unitarian Universalists, religious education includes all of the ways that children, teens and adults grow toward their potential as compassionate, ethical and fulfilled human beings. Our RE program is grounded in our Unitarian Universalist Principles and Sources, and in our relationships with one another.
